#include "qp_port.h"
|
|
#include "dpp.h"
|
|
#include "bsp.h"
|
|
|
|
namespace DPP {
|
|
|
|
// Local-scope objects -------------------------------------------------------
|
|
static QP::QEvt const *l_tableQueueSto[N_PHILO];
|
|
static QP::QEvt const *l_philoQueueSto[N_PHILO][N_PHILO];
|
|
static QP::QSubscrList l_subscrSto[MAX_PUB_SIG];
|
|
|
|
static QF_MPOOL_EL(TableEvt) l_smlPoolSto[2*N_PHILO];//storage for small epool
|
|
|
|
//............................................................................
|
|
extern "C" int_t main(void) {
|
|
|
|
QP::QF::init(); // initialize the framework and the underlying RT kernel
|
|
|
|
BSP_init(); // initialize the BSP
|
|
|
|
// object dictionaries...
|
|
QS_OBJ_DICTIONARY(l_smlPoolSto);
|
|
QS_OBJ_DICTIONARY(l_tableQueueSto);
|
|
QS_OBJ_DICTIONARY(l_philoQueueSto[0]);
|
|
QS_OBJ_DICTIONARY(l_philoQueueSto[1]);
|
|
QS_OBJ_DICTIONARY(l_philoQueueSto[2]);
|
|
QS_OBJ_DICTIONARY(l_philoQueueSto[3]);
|
|
QS_OBJ_DICTIONARY(l_philoQueueSto[4]);
|
|
|
|
QP::QF::psInit(l_subscrSto, Q_DIM(l_subscrSto)); // init publish-subscribe
|
|
|
|
// initialize event pools...
|
|
QP::QF::poolInit(l_smlPoolSto,
|
|
sizeof(l_smlPoolSto), sizeof(l_smlPoolSto[0]));
|
|
|
|
// start the active objects...
|
|
for (uint8_t n = 0U; n < N_PHILO; ++n) {
|
|
AO_Philo[n]->start((uint8_t)(n + 1U),
|
|
l_philoQueueSto[n], Q_DIM(l_philoQueueSto[n]),
|
|
(void *)0, 0U);
|
|
}
|
|
AO_Table->start((uint8_t)(N_PHILO + 1U),
|
|
l_tableQueueSto, Q_DIM(l_tableQueueSto),
|
|
(void *)0, 0U);
|
|
|
|
return QP::QF::run(); // run the QF application
|
|
}
|
|
|
|
} // namespace DPP
